The Efficiency Of EPS Formwork In The Construction Industry

EPS formwork, also known as Expanded Polystyrene formwork, is becoming increasingly popular in the construction industry due to its efficiency and cost-effectiveness This innovative formwork system is revolutionizing the way buildings and structures are erected, providing numerous benefits for both builders and project owners.

EPS formwork is made from expanded polystyrene, a lightweight and durable material that is easy to handle and transport The formwork pieces are typically custom-made to fit the specific requirements of a construction project, ensuring a precise and efficient building process This customization allows for flexibility in design, making it ideal for projects with unique architectural specifications.

One of the primary advantages of EPS formwork is its speed of installation Due to its lightweight nature, EPS formwork can be easily maneuvered and assembled on-site, speeding up the construction timeline significantly Builders can save time and money by reducing labor costs and completing projects faster than traditional formwork systems.

The efficiency of EPS formwork also translates into cost savings for project owners With reduced labor requirements and a shorter construction schedule, overall project costs can be significantly lower compared to traditional formwork methods Additionally, the lightweight nature of EPS formwork reduces the need for heavy machinery, further decreasing construction expenses.

Another key benefit of EPS formwork is its environmental sustainability Expanded polystyrene is a recyclable material, making it an eco-friendly choice for construction projects By using EPS formwork, builders can reduce waste and minimize their environmental impact, contributing to a more sustainable construction industry.

In addition to its efficiency and cost-effectiveness, EPS formwork also offers superior thermal insulation properties The expanded polystyrene material acts as a barrier against heat transfer, helping to maintain a comfortable indoor temperature in buildings eps formwork. This insulation can lead to energy savings for building owners, reducing heating and cooling costs over the lifespan of the structure.

Furthermore, EPS formwork is known for its durability and longevity The high-density expanded polystyrene material is resistant to moisture, mold, and pests, ensuring that the formwork remains structurally sound throughout the construction process This durability can result in reduced maintenance requirements and a longer lifespan for the building or structure.

The versatility of EPS formwork is another advantage that sets it apart from traditional formwork systems Builders can easily create complex shapes and designs using EPS formwork, allowing for innovative and creative architectural solutions Whether it is curved walls, unique facades, or intricate structures, EPS formwork can accommodate a wide range of design possibilities.
